| Abstract |
Outlines a frequency domain analysis of the dynamic factor model and proposes a solution to the problem of constructing a causal filter of lagged factor loadings. The method is illustrated with applications to simulated and real multivariate time series. The latter applications involve topographic analysis of the multichannel % including a comparison with time-varying dipole modeling of brain potentials.
